IN consideration of the fact that at the present time two Agents of the Australian Pas'oralists' Union aro in New Zealand trying to engage shearers for Australia, Members and Non-members are warned Not to accept any Engagement through the A. P. agents, or take any steps calculated to overthrow the joint agreement of 1891. WILLIAM ROBERTSON, Secretary, Gore Branch 28ju N.Z. Workers' Union.
